/*
 * RECEIPT_TEMPLATE_VERSION — Almsbridge donation-receipt mailer.
 *
 * This constant pins the template revision used when rendering
 * tax receipts. Do NOT bump it mid-fiscal-year: regenerated
 * receipts must be byte-identical to the originals donors already
 * hold, or reconciliation at year-end breaks. Changes require
 * sign-off from the compliance group and a migration note in the
 * ledger repo. When auditing a discrepancy, first confirm which
 * build produced the receipt by checking the token recorded below.
 */

session token of tajef-bageg = htk21_5d90d574934f3ccae6437

## Profilecore Environments

Profilecore shards the user-profile store by account hash. Three environments: dev (single shard, resets nightly), staging (four shards, production-like routing), prod (sixteen shards, rebalancing enabled). Plugin authors: never compute shard placement yourselves — call the routing API. Cross-shard queries are disabled in prod; batch lookups must go through the fan-out endpoint. Staging data is synthetic; do not assume real distribution. Each environment's shard map and routing parameters are listed below.

settings of bafof-fajog:
[aldix]
port = 9300
region = north-3
host = aldix.kelvilabs.example
team = istath
timeout_ms = 1500
retries = 8

Q: What should on-call do if the user-module split from the Ledgerbird monolith locks out the migration account? A: Pause the extraction job first, verify the shadow database at Norrell is consistent, then initiate account recovery from the operations console. The recovery flow will ask for the stored passphrase, which appears below.

unlock words, kajef-kadug: sorys-pelax-lamael-tamvan-briiel-novdor-fenwyn-tamdor-oliion-keleth-julok-belion-ralok